WebFor the purpose of paying a recruitment incentive, the definition of newly appointed is found in Title 5, CFR 575.102. A recruitment incentive may be paid to an individual who has not yet entered on duty if the individual has accepted a written offer of employment and has signed a service agreement as outlined in Title 5, CFR 575.109 (d).
